So what exactly are we talking about? A tabletop Christmas tree is a somewhat generic name for almost any small Christmas tree. They fit almost anywhere, often on tabletops, desk tops, corner tables, and mantles. They'll often even be on the floor but are smaller than most trees and do not take much space. Also, they are often artificial meaning not only is there less fuss and mess, but there are a multitude of options available!
